Output 58bc13a13f2737df0580bfcdec10a99cc506395e00c83d8641e8000bdbda706e:1

value
5508124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33ba324d9b5dab2ada841fba245bb42ffa10ca36 OP_EQUAL
address
MCcfkNaoLcR3r47s54o7NAxBLAtvkyNGjP
transaction
58bc13a13f2737df0580bfcdec10a99cc506395e00c83d8641e8000bdbda706e
spent
true